I cut a windshield out with a utility knife that has the changeable razor blades. The windshield was in my 97 crew cab. I will say I will never do that again. Biggest PIA! Needless to say I broke the windshield. If there are any cracks or chips, you will be wasting your time trying to remove it without the tools the pros use.

I'm with everyone else. Pay to have it done.
